    Make the most of the snow-covered landscapes of the Lanaudière region with a day of snowshoeing and tree climbing with ziplining in Rawdon from Montreal!

    An incredible way to make the most of the snow in Quebec this winter, this day of snowshoeing and tree climbing in Rawdon from Montreal will give you an unforgettable nature getaway with your family or friends. With minibus transport included from the Radisson metro station in Montreal, you will be able to reach the wide-open spaces of the Lanaudière region to enjoy some of Quebec's must-do outdoor activities!

    You will head to Abraska park to start the day with a canopy tour in Rawdon, featuring suspension bridges, lianas, monkey bridges and even zip lines in the heart of the snow-covered forest. This will be followed by a short break around a campfire to grill some marshmallows, then lunch before setting off on a snowshoe hike up Mont Pontbriand, close to Abraska park. At the summit, 318 metres above sea level, you will be treated to a superb panoramic view of Rawdon and the surrounding area - the perfect way to round off your day in the Lanaudière region from Montreal!

    Offer Description

    A day including a 2.5-hour tree climbing course with zip lines and a snowshoe hike on Mont Pontbriand

    Course of events

    - Meeting at Radisson metro station in Montreal

    - Minibus journey with guide/driver to Abraska Park (approx. 1 hour's drive)

    - Briefing on the snowshoe hike on Mont Pontbriand

    - Departure for 2-hour of free snowshoe hike

    - Lunch break

     

    - Distribution of tree climbing equipment and briefing on the course and safety instructions

    - Departure for approximately 2.5-hour of tree climbing in the forest

    - Campfire break with hot chocolate and marshmallows

    - Return to Montreal by minibus (about 1 hour's drive) and end of the experience
